Variability of flower number and fertilization in various generations of selfing in sunflower (Helianthus annuus L.)

The objective of this study was to use disc flower number and seed number per plant to assess the effects of particular variation sources on the variation of fertilization rate per plant and variability and grouping within the self-pollinated sunflower lines in different generations of inbreeding. The study was conducted using 155 self-pollinated lines in different generations of self-pollination. Ten different lines were obtained whose average number of disc flowers per plant ranged between 1500 and 2000. The trait with the largest variability in the lines of the S6 selfed generation was seed number per plant. The overall coefficient of variation for the lines was 26.5%. Lines of the S6 generation were developed whose mean values of the traits concerned were higher than the average values of the same traits relative to the resulting materials. The overall mean value for flower number per plant in the lines of the S6 generation was 1034. The minimum was recorded in line 35899/34 (547) and the maximum in line 865424/27 (2007). The overall mean value of seed number per plant was 533, with the minimum having been recorded in 358913/1 (217) and the maximum in 865417/30 (1127). The average fertilization rate per plant was 53.47%, ranging from 7.7% in 865418/2 to 78.7% in 93223/15. Three S6 self-pollinated sunflower lines were obtained with respect to seed number and fertilization rate per plant, namely 86356/11, 93223/34 and 932213/13.
